Robert Speranza
About Robert Speranza
Robert Speranza serves as the Senior Vice President – Professional (Canada GM / Business Unit Leader) at Advance Auto Parts, where he has driven sales and EBITDA growth through strategic initiatives. He holds a Bachelor's degree in Business from Miami University and an MBA in Finance from Babson F.W. Olin Graduate School of Business.

Previous Experience at Advance Auto Parts
Prior to his current role, Robert Speranza was the Senior Vice President – Strategy & Transformation (Retail) at Advance Auto Parts from 2018 to 2022. In this capacity, he was responsible for driving strategic initiatives that transformed retail operations, enhancing customer engagement, and improving overall business performance.
Career at PepsiCo
Robert Speranza held multiple leadership roles at PepsiCo, including Region Vice President for the Frito-Lay Division from 2011 to 2013 and Vice President General Manager for the Lipton Partnership in North America from 2014 to 2016. He played a key role in architecting the turnaround of a single region and integrating two Frito-Lay operating regions to enhance performance. Additionally, he was involved in the $200 million acquisition of the DieHard business.

Achievements in Brand Management
During his tenure at PepsiCo, Robert Speranza successfully returned the Pure Leaf, Lipton, and Brisk trademarks to growth in the tea category. This was achieved through strategic investments in brand and product innovation, demonstrating his capability in driving brand performance and market share.
